What affects car insurance prices in Spain?

1) Mandatory vs optional coverage

In Spain, at least third-party liability insurance is legally required to drive. From there, many drivers add protection depending on vehicle age and risk tolerance:

  • Third party only: cheapest legal option, limited protection for your own car.
  • Third party + fire & theft: common for mid-value used vehicles.
  • Comprehensive: broadest protection, often chosen for newer or financed cars.

2) Bonus-malus and claim history

Like other EU markets, Spain strongly rewards clean driving history. More no-claims years typically reduce premium, while at-fault claims push prices higher at renewal. If you have claim-free years from another country, ask the insurer whether they can recognize your previous certificate.

3) Vehicle profile

Insurers review your car value, power, theft risk, repair cost, and replacement part prices. Higher-value or high-performance vehicles usually cost more to insure. On older vehicles, many drivers lower costs by moving from comprehensive to third party + fire/theft.

4) Annual mileage and parking

More kilometers usually means greater accident exposure. Parking also matters: street parking in dense urban areas tends to increase both collision and vandalism risk compared with locked private parking.

5) Location and local claims frequency

Premiums may vary by province and city due to traffic density, fraud rates, theft frequency, and average claim severity. Two drivers with similar cars can still receive different prices based on where the car is normally kept.

How to lower your car insurance premium in Spain

  • Compare policies from multiple insurers and specialist expat brokers.
  • Increase deductible if you can comfortably cover minor losses.
  • Choose only add-ons you actually need.
  • Store your vehicle in a secure garage where possible.
  • Keep mileage declarations realistic and accurate.
  • Protect your no-claims history by avoiding small claims you can self-fund.
  • Bundle products (car + home) when discounts are attractive.

Important notes before buying

Always check policy wording, exclusions, territorial limits, roadside terms, replacement car conditions, and windscreen cover details. Confirm whether your policy includes legal assistance and what happens after a total loss. The cheapest quote is not always the best value if claim support is weak.

Frequently asked questions

Is this calculator valid for electric cars in Spain?

Yes as a rough estimate. For EVs, real quotes may differ due to battery cost, repair network, and model-specific claim data.

Can young drivers get affordable insurance in Spain?

Yes, but premiums are often high initially. Choosing a lower-power vehicle, adding a secure parking location, and building no-claims history are usually the fastest ways to reduce long-term cost.

Does deductible always make insurance cheaper?

Usually yes, especially for comprehensive cover. However, savings vary by insurer. Compare net savings versus the out-of-pocket amount you would pay during a claim.
